The Best Hair Routine for Brunettes β NYC Master Colorist Guide
Brunette hair is naturally rich, shiny, and dimensional β but it can fade, turn brassy, or look dull without the right routine. Whether youβre a dark chocolate brunette, caramel balayage, mocha, or chestnut, this guide will help you maintain your shade beautifully.
1. Wash Your Hair 2β3 Times per Week
Overwashing causes brunette color to fade quickly, especially warm or balayage brunettes.
Best routine:
- Wash 2β3 times weekly
- Use warm β not hot β water
- Finish with cool water to seal shine
2. Use Sulfate-Free Shampoo
Sulfates pull out brunette pigments and expose unwanted red/orange undertones. A gentle sulfate-free shampoo preserves your depth and tone.
3. Deep Condition Every Week
Brunette hair needs moisture to stay shiny, silky, and reflective.
- Use hydrating masks once a week
- Choose repair masks for highlighted brunettes
4. Add Shine Serum Daily
Shine is EVERYTHING for brunettes. A small amount of serum keeps hair glossy and frizz-free.
Apply to mid-shaft & ends daily.
5. Gloss Every 6β8 Weeks
Glosses deepen brunette tones, reduce brass, add shine, and seal the cuticle.
- Mocha β use neutral or cool gloss
- Chestnut β warm caramel gloss
- Balayage brunettes β neutral beige gloss
- Dark brunettes β deep cocoa gloss
Glossing is the secret to expensive-looking brunettes.
6. Protect from Heat
Heat fades brunette pigment faster and causes orange tones to appear.
- Use heat protectant every time
- Keep hot tools under 350Β°F
7. Avoid Hard Water (NYC Issue)
NYC water causes brunette hair to fade and turn warm or brassy.
- Use clarifying shampoo weekly
- Schedule monthly detox treatments
8. Salon Maintenance Schedule
- Full color: every 6β10 weeks
- Balayage refresh: every 3β6 months
- Gloss: every 6β8 weeks
- Haircut: every 8β12 weeks
